On 5/20/2015 12:39 PM, PGNd wrote: > With my current ISP I have a static allocation over DSL, setup as > > 'net > | > ISP's GW > | > ADSL bridge > | > | (staticIP} > Router/Firewall: shorewall > > I use a MultiISP config, that includes > > /params > #NAME # MARK DUP INTC GW OPTS COPY > ispStatic 1 0x100 main EXT_IF detect track,balance > INT_IF > ... > > With this config, IIUC, the GW == 'detect' populates $SW_ETH0_GATEWAY with > the IP addr of "ISP GW". > > I'm switching ISP to ATT Uverse, where I'll have a Dynamic IP allocation > > 'net > | > ISP's GW > | > | (dynamic IP) > Uverse router > | (NAT'd DMZ IP == 192.168.4.XXX, "Static" ) > | > Router/Firewall: shorewall > > 'detect' in the /params stanza as above won't get the ISP's GW any longer, > will it? > > What do I need to change that /params entry to in order to correctly grab > that ISP GW addr? Usually nothing. If Shorewall isn't able to detect the gateway, then you may have to use the 'findgw' extension script to dig it out of your DHCP client's files in /var.
